I have no number for how many kidnapper-captive / master-slave books I have read. And after so many years and so many books, I think I found the perfect one in this genre. One which actually shows the gradual growth in the relationship. Which doesn't go from 5 days to 5 weeks to "and months passed like this". That stage did come, but very much later. This book gave very much well-required attention to the attachment building. Top it all with despite knowing every hour of the first 2-3 months of the couple (?) - this story didn't get repetitive or boring!
I have read books much much hardcore than this, but this was good in a way it didn't just focus on the physical torture portion of the trope. Actual torture was in fact very tame considering things I've read. This was more of a two very intelligent beings trying to manipulate each other in order to get what they want, leading to - both of them coming to terms with the gradually changing, evolving power dynamic. 
It was all this could end only one of the two ways. But this story even in this overwritten trope found a new way to reach the ending.
Every single Kidnapper-captive turned couple results in the kidnapper falling in love and setting them free only for them to come back, or the captive running away only for them to realise they can't live alone now, and returning. Well, this one here definitely had a twist to that. 
I definitely hadn't expected this story to actually be something. I mean, don't be confused, this is definitely smut. But even for a smut to be good, it needs to have a good background, a good story. And this book - definitely has it.

To begin, my rating is how much I liked the book, not necessarily a comment on its quality or how much anyone happening on this review might like it. 

At NO point did this book read as a romance to me, only a slow moving horror with no happy ending. She is kidnapped early on and made not only into this guy’s sex slave but ALSO his cook and maid (idk why this added so much salt to the wound but it really did for me like just hire a cook and a maid man you’re rich pay your employees). 

I am not a prude, I don’t mind reading bdsm or non-con but this just had no element of eroticism at all for me. It read like an unhinged misogynist kidnaps this woman, tortures her, NEVER compromises, and does absolutely anything he wants without consequence. It’s terrifying and makes me feel sick to imagine. I kept reading hoping at some point either (in order of how happy i would be with the ending) she would escape and kill him, she would escape and visit him in prison, or she would convince him what he was doing was wrong, he would grovel, and they would try to build a real relationship while maintaining the bdsm elements. What actually happened was BEYOND my worst case scenario and I cannot believe this is anything other than a horror novel with that ending.

A little about the heroine, she manages a couple of moments of control (between beatings, sexual assault, domestic labour, and trying to appease a crazy person’s ego) and flubs it EVERY TIME. Because of her oh-so-gentle soul she refuses to hurt him and feels SO much regret when she does. I have never related less to a character in my life. Absolutely no survival instinct, no self esteem, and no sense of justice.
